The timeline was tiny bit more confusing than that... The episode started out with her injuries on the cheek. At that moment, we don't have a clue whether it is taking place in the present or in the past. After the opening theme, Hanekawa appears once again as Araragi is talking to Sengoku. She displays her symptom there. When Araragi starts to wonder if this is the same as the time during the golden week, the flashback starts. The episode ends in the present when Hanekawa points out about the question marks of a guy who is openly walking with girls' school mizugi. There was a lot of information about what brings out the Black Hanekawa. I'll call her Shiroi Hanekawa form as Black Hanekawa because it's aptly misleading, equally amusing, and yet describes the other Hanekawa perfectly. She is a bad kitty once in that form. Oshino says that she transforms in that form as a stress relief mechanism when she is under a tremendous amount of stress. What gives her those stress? Exams? boyfriend? Family? Thinking about that first scene, her family is most certainly the source of her stress. That's also seem to be the first clue about the opening scene was taking place in the past. The 2nd clue was when she touched and picked up that dead cat for a burial. Sawari neko.

I'm speculating here of course. I'm not certain if I'm correct, but that's how I reasoned the opening scene happened in the past and what lead to her eventual transformation in the upcoming Golden Week.

The flow of interesting information about Hanekawa continues and gives more ammunition for further speculation. As shown, Hanekawa was bitten by Shinobu. Since she is high up in the food chain, being a vampire and all, she was able to energy-drain the Black Hanekawa aka Shirai Neko to the usual Hanekawa. Speculation starts here.....

Hanekawa never had a resolution to her Black Hanekawa problem. It simply means that Black Hanekawa never appeared since Shinobu's own version of energy drain on Black Hanekawa.

The question is why didn't Hanekawa transform into Black Hanekawa since then? The answer is she coped with her stress one way or the other since then instead of letting it built to a critical stage which would trigger the Black Hanekawa transformation.

So what were those steps she took to keep the stress at a tolerable level?

She stayed away from home as long as possible. She talked to Araragi and enjoyed spending time with him. A certain checks-and-balance was reached to keep the Black Hanekawa at bay. All signs of symptoms disappeared...... well, until now.
